网站悬浮广告素材wordpress添加logo
2026/4/15 14:54:37 网站建设 项目流程
网站悬浮广告素材,wordpress添加logo,深圳企业网站建设怎么做,昆明市城市基本建设档案馆网站快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a; 使用快马平台对比展示传统C和C2015在开发效率上的差异。创建两个相同功能的项目#xff1a;1. 使用C98标准#xff1b;2. 使用C2015标准。比较代码量、开发时间和性能指标#…快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容使用快马平台对比展示传统C和C2015在开发效率上的差异。创建两个相同功能的项目1. 使用C98标准2. 使用C2015标准。比较代码量、开发时间和性能指标生成对比报告。点击项目生成按钮等待项目生成完整后预览效果作为一名长期使用C的开发者最近在InsCode(快马)平台上做了一个有趣的对比实验结果让我对C2015的效率提升有了更直观的认识。今天就来分享这个对比过程以及现代C带来的开发体验升级。实验设计思路我选择实现一个常见的文件处理工具功能包括读取文本文件、统计词频、排序输出。这个需求足够典型能覆盖字符串处理、容器操作、算法等常见场景。传统C98的实现痛点手动内存管理需要频繁使用new/delete稍不注意就会内存泄漏冗长的类型声明迭代器类型要写完整命名空间比如std::vector ::iterator缺乏智能指针必须自己实现资源管理算法组合困难每个操作都要写循环代码重复率高C2015的现代化改造auto关键字让代码更简洁编译器自动推导类型范围for循环替代传统迭代器遍历lambda表达式实现内联函数逻辑智能指针自动管理资源标准库新增的算法可以直接组合使用具体效率对比数据在快马平台创建两个项目记录关键指标代码行数C98版本287行 vs C2015版本142行开发时间从3小时缩短到1小时内存安全性C2015版本零内存错误报告可读性评分代码复杂度降低40%最具价值的新特性auto和decltype减少50%的类型声明代码lambda表达式使回调代码更集中std::move提升容器操作效率线程库原生支持并发编程实际开发中的体验升级错误更少类型系统更强大编译期就能发现更多问题调试更简单智能指针自动处理资源释放重构更容易代码意图更清晰扩展性更好模块化程度提高性能优化惊喜原本担心高级抽象会影响性能实测发现移动语义避免了不必要的拷贝编译器优化更智能最终性能反而提升约15%团队协作优势代码风格更统一接口设计更清晰新人上手更快代码审查更高效在InsCode(快马)平台做这个对比特别方便它的在线编辑器支持多种C标准可以实时看到不同版本的编译结果。最让我惊喜的是部署功能写完代码一键就能运行测试不用折腾本地环境。对于C开发者来说升级到现代C绝对是值得的投资。刚开始可能需要适应新语法但很快就会感受到生产力的大幅提升。如果你还在用老版本标准不妨在快马平台创建个项目试试新特性相信会有和我一样的惊喜。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容使用快马平台对比展示传统C和C2015在开发效率上的差异。创建两个相同功能的项目1. 使用C98标准2. 使用C2015标准。比较代码量、开发时间和性能指标生成对比报告。点击项目生成按钮等待项目生成完整后预览效果

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询